The Special Forces for Environmental Security have detained a citizen for violating environmental regulations by camping without a permit in Imam Faisal bin Turki Royal Reserve. Legal measures have been taken against the individual.

The forces explained that camping in forests or national parks without a permit carries a fine of up to 3,000 riyals (SAR). They urged the public to report any violations against the environment or wildlife by calling 911 in the regions of Makkah, Madinah, Riyadh, and the Eastern Province, or 999 and 996 in other regions of the Kingdom. Authorities stressed that all reports will be handled with complete confidentiality and without any liability for the informant.
